Your home is the first organization you ever run.
But there's no operating system for it.

One person holds the mental model of the entire household — who needs what, when things are due, which vendor to call, what's in the fridge, whose turn it is. That invisible labor compounds silently until something breaks: a missed appointment, a forgotten payment, a fight about dishes.

AI is transforming how people work. But the domestic sphere — where we spend the most time and feel the most stress — hasn't changed at all. Dwellsmith is building the system your household has been running without.

The operating system for domestic life.

Dwellsmith makes invisible work visible. Tasks, routines, relationships, maintenance schedules, vendor coordination, meal planning, personal care — all the things someone in your household is tracking in their head, captured in a shared system everyone can see.

It's AI-native from day one. Tell it what you need in plain language. It learns your household's rhythms, generates maintenance plans when you buy a house, orchestrates your meal prep, and coordinates your vendors — through conversation, not forms.

The result: less friction, fairer distribution of labor, and a genuinely better quality of life for everyone under your roof.

You can't delegate what you can't see.

Smart kitchen appliances are already cooking. Robot vacuums already clean floors. Humanoid robots are entering homes. But none of them know your household — what needs doing, when, how often, or why it matters.

Before you can hand work to a machine, someone has to make that work legible. That's the step everyone skips. Dwellsmith is building the semantic layer of domestic life — the structured knowledge that turns "I just know what needs doing" into instructions any agent, device, or person can follow.

Today, we make invisible work visible. Tomorrow, we coordinate it across your household. Eventually, we become the operating system that robots, AI agents, and smart devices plug into — so they work in harmony with how your home actually runs, not how some manufacturer imagined it.
